Transaction

77ff62b946ae1c6a28248e44684e20199e167638404f135d93815ff5a6179168

Summary

In Block258467
TimeFri, 07 Jul 2023 07:00:30 UTC
Total Input767.29215888 Nebula
Total Output822.29215888 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
830267 Confirmations822.29215888 Nebula
Raw Transaction